Raimund Schreier
Raimund Schreier OPraem (born December 29, 1952 in Innsbruck ) is an Austrian Premonstratensian and 55th Abbot of Wilten Abbey . Since 2017 he has also been the Grand Prior of the Austrian Lieutenancy of the Knightly Order of the Holy Sepulcher in Jerusalem .
Life
Raimund Schreier grew up in Völs. He stepped on September 13, 1971, the canon community of Norbertine at. In 1972 he made his profession and was ordained a priest on May 19, 1977 after his philosophical and theological training . He worked as a cantor and religion teacher at the Amras elementary school, at the secondary school in Wilten and at the Pedagogical Academy (PÄDAK) as well as at the Academic Gymnasium Innsbruck Angerzellgasse , one of the oldest schools in the German-speaking area . He also worked as a spiritual director in the Norbertinum Student Convict of Wilten Abbey and as administrator and rector of the Wilten Boys' Choir .
In 1992 he was elected 55th Abbot of the Premonstratensian Monastery of Wilten. The benediction was donated to him on May 29, 1992 by Reinhold Stecher , Bishop of Innsbruck. His motto is “Ut credat mundus - So that the world may believe.” In 2014 he was confirmed in office for a further 12 years. As prelate of Wilten, he is also house, court and hereditary chaplain of the state of Tyrol . He is chairman of the Superior Conference of Men's Orders in the Diocese of Innsbruck .
He is a member of the Catholic secondary school associations K.Ö.St.V. Teutonia zu Innsbruck and K.Ö.St.V Amelungia zu Innsbruck in the MKV and the student association AV Austria Innsbruck in the ÖCV .
Order of Knights of the Holy Sepulcher in Jerusalem
Schreier is committed to numerous social projects in the Holy Land . In 1996 he was appointed Grand Officer of the Order of the Knights of the Holy Sepulcher in Jerusalem by Cardinal Grand Master Carlo Cardinal Furno and invested by Alois Stöger , Grand Prior of the Order in Austria. From 1996 to 2017 Schreier was Prior of the Innsbruck Commandery. On February 28, 2017, Cardinal Grand Master Edwin Frederick O'Brien was appointed Grand Prior of the Austrian Lieutenancy of the Order of the Knights of the Holy Sepulcher in Jerusalem.
honors and awards
- Grand Officer of the Order of the Knights of the Holy Sepulcher (1996)
- Ring of Honor of the City of Innsbruck (2004)
- Grand Cross of the Order of Merit Pro Merito Melitensi of the Sovereign Order of Malta (2005)
